Firefly Aerospace's Blue Ghost Mission 1 made its historic lunar landing this morning, March 2, at 3:34 AM EST. Firefly is only the second private company to achieve a soft lunar landing, and the Blue Ghost lander is carrying a payload of NASA scientific equipment as part of the CLPS and Artemis lunar mission programs.

The Leica I was unveiled 100 years ago today, on March 1, 1925. The Leica I, the first mass-produced 35mm Leica camera, is widely celebrated for its influence on photography.
